
NSW has recorded 11 new cases today, all locally acquired. That statistic includes a third person in a Newcastle family.
It's not just that positive test but the ramifications for the city and surrounds. Two schools are closed for cleaning and thousands in the city have been sent into self-isolation.
Sports fixtures have been called off and testing sites are working overtime.
